el-tooltip 如何鼠标离开立即消失? 我用自定义指令做的 tooltipHide: { inserted: function (el) { const tooltipId = el.attributes['aria-describedby'].nodeValue; el.immediateHide = () => { const tooltipEl = document.getElementById(tooltipId); tooltipEl.style.display = 'none'; }; el.addEventL...
尝试在 el-tooltip 组件中将 transition 属性设为空,以消除渐变消失效果。但这一操作并未解决残影问题。进一步研究后,发现关键在于调整 open-delay 属性,该属性默认值为 0,意味着鼠标一进入区域组件即刻显示。将此值延迟设定为大于 450 毫秒,可确保 el-tooltip 组件在鼠标进入区域后延迟一定时间再显示...
方法/步骤 1 打开一个vue文件,添加一个el-tooltip文字提示组件。如图 2 在el-tooltip标签上添加disabled属性,设置值为true,用于设置鼠标滑过不显示提示内容。如图 3 保存vue文件后使用浏览器打开,鼠标滑过提示文字发现提示内容不显示了。如图
方案一:style中设置.focusing{display: none;}这个在我自己写的demo项目里面没有问题,场景比较简单,按钮的事件是弹出confirm和跳转到百度都没有问题。但是在项目中有一个场景有问题然后就又找了方案二 方案二:监听表格的滚动事件,然后设置el-tooltip不显示。参考资料地址:https://blog.csdn.net/bao...
方法一、render-header=“renderPrice”(此方法无法使tooltip换行) 只是单纯的想在table中添加图标和tooltip 在el-table-column中绑定:render-header=“renderPrice”(此方法无法使tooltip换行) <el-table-column label="age" align="center" width="200"> ...
但却不可以将鼠标移入提示窗,导致一些关键信息不能选择复制等问题。 翻看了下源码 node_modules/element-ui/packages/table/src/table-body.js 246行,使用 createRange 与cell 宽度对比决定 当前cell 是否需要 tooltip。
import tableTooltip from './table-tooltip' export default { name: 'home', components: { tableTooltip }, data() { return { tableData: [{ address: '上海市这段文本超长超长超长的普陀区金沙江路 1518 弄' }}], tableCellMouse: { cellDom: null, // 鼠标移入的cell-dom ...
可以设置:append-to-body="false"后这种一个div来进行存放当前不在body的popper <el-tooltip placement="top"ref="tooltip":popper-class="tooltipClass":disabled="!showTooltip":append-to-body="isAppendBody" > {{ formatValue }} </el-tooltip> mounted() {...
要实现鼠标点击触发,我们需要利用 Vue 的事件绑定机制,以及可能需要对 el-tooltip 进行一些样式或行为的自定义。 3. 编写代码实现 el-tooltip 鼠标点击触发功能 我们可以通过在点击事件中手动控制 el-tooltip 的显示和隐藏来实现这一功能。以下是一个示例代码: ...